최대 1 분 소요

Perl로 짠 스크립트를 Window에서 exe로 돌리고자 할 때가 있다..

나는 대용량 자료 처리를 필요로 하는 코드를 일단 Perl로 짠 후에

C#, JAVA 프로그램의 뒤에서 돌게 시키는 편이다.

Perl을 exe로 바꿔주는 좋은 툴이있는데, 안타깝게도 유료($295)다....

다행히도(?) 21 Trial 버전을 사용할 수 있어서... 좋다.....!! 했는데

이 툴을 이용해서 생성한 exe는 한달 동안만 동작한다고 한다...



**이 프로그램은 펄이 깔려있어야 동작한다.
이 전 포스팅에 펄 까는법이 나와있으니 먼저 깔고 시작!



1. 다운받기
http://www.activestate.com/perl-dev-kit

에서, 중간에 Try Now를 눌러서 다운받자.

64비트, 32비트(x86) 구분해서 받아야 한다..

다운받은 파일 설치는 그냥.. 다음 다음 눌러서 설치하면 끝.


2. 변환하기

시작->모든 프로그램 -> ActiveState Perl Dev-kit -> PerlApp을 실행시킨다.

이런 화면이 뜨는데, Script 부분에서 변환하고자 하는 pl 파일을 불러온다.

이렇게! 불러와지면, Target을 지정한다.

일반 윈도우에서 돌릴 거라면, Windows(native)를 선택해야 한다


이렇게하면 32비트든 64비트든 Windows라면 잘 실행된다
(프로그램을 돌릴 컴퓨터에 펄이 안깔려 있어도 된다)

64비트 컴퓨터에서만 돌릴거라면 Target을 Windows x64로 지정하면 되고,

리눅스, 솔라리스 등 다른 옵션도 선택 가능하다.

다 설정이 끝났으면 Make Executable을 누르자

위와 같이 Created가 되고, 파일 사이즈도 뜨고,

[DONE]이 뜨면 성공적으로 exe파일을 생성한 것이다.

저기 파란색 Warning을 보면 알겠지만.... Trial 버전이라, 9월 30일까지밖에 못쓴다고 한다 으엉엉....

이 프로그램이 꼭 필요하신 분은 $295를 내고 사세...요.......

*덧, 크랙을 찾아보았으나 Keygen이 전부 바이러스에 걸려있었다.....
그냥.. 정품을 사용하라는 하늘의 계시인가보다............
나는 다행히, 이번엔 Trial 버전으로도 괜찮았기 때문에 OK.




카테고리:

업데이트:

댓글남기기